揭秘JavaScript简易游戏:Jan-Ken-Pon主逻辑
下载需积分: 9 | ZIP格式 | 220KB |
更新于2025-01-03
| 87 浏览量 | 举报
资源摘要信息:"简肯庞"作为标题,提示我们接下来的内容将与游戏相关,同时"游戏sederhana,文档,对象模型"作为描述,表明这个文件所涉及的游戏是简单类型的,且将使用文档化的方法来描述其对象模型。此外,标签"JavaScript"揭示了该文件可能与编程语言JavaScript相关。最后,"Jan-Ken-Pon-main"作为压缩包子文件的文件名称列表,暗示了游戏的名称可能是“Jan Ken Pon”,而"main"可能表示这是主文件或者主要的文件集合。
从这些信息中,我们可以推断出以下知识点:
1. 简肯庞游戏介绍:
简肯庞(Jan Ken Pon)是一个流行的手游戏,有时也被称为剪刀石头布。它是一个非常简单但广泛流行的游戏,通常用来解决争端或者作为决定胜负的方式。游戏规则简单,两个玩家同时出拳,其中拳头代表剪刀,手掌代表布,伸出手掌的两指代表石头,互相之间的胜负关系为:石头胜剪刀,剪刀胜布,布胜石头。
2. 游戏的简单性(Sederhana):
在软件开发中,“简单性”是一个重要的原则,它强调软件设计应避免不必要的复杂性,使得系统更易于维护和理解。描述中提到游戏的“简单性”可能意味着游戏的规则直白、易于理解,而且在设计上也应该追求简洁明了的代码结构。
3. 文档化(文档):
文档化是软件开发中的一个关键环节,它指的是对软件的设计、功能和实现细节进行详细记录的过程。好的文档能够帮助开发者理解系统的结构,便于团队协作,同时也有助于日后的维护和扩展。文档化可以包括需求文档、设计文档、用户手册等。
4. 对象模型(对象模型):
对象模型是面向对象编程(OOP)中的一个核心概念,它描述了系统中对象的结构和它们之间的关系。对象模型包括类和对象的概念,类是对具有相同属性和方法的对象的抽象,对象是类的具体实例。JavaScript虽然是基于原型的脚本语言,但它在ES6之后的版本中引入了类的概念,这使得在JavaScript中实现和理解对象模型变得更为直观和容易。
5. JavaScript编程语言:
JavaScript是一种高级的、解释型的编程语言,主要用于网页开发,以实现动态和交互式网页效果。JavaScript是基于原型的、多范式语言,支持面向对象、命令式和声明式(如函数式编程)等编程范式。JavaScript在前端开发中扮演着核心角色,同时Node.js的出现也让JavaScript能够运行在服务器端。
6. 压缩包子文件(Jan-Ken-Pon-main):
压缩包子文件可能是指一个包含游戏源代码、资源文件、文档和可能的测试脚本的压缩包。在软件开发中,将所有相关文件组织在一个主文件夹中是一种常见的做法,这有助于代码的分发和部署。该文件夹名为“main”,表明这可能是游戏项目的根目录,包含了游戏的主要组件。
总结来说,"简肯庞"文件包含了关于如何使用JavaScript开发一个简单游戏的信息,这个游戏可能是剪刀石头布,并且强调了编写清晰文档和构建简洁的对象模型的重要性。通过上述知识点的展开,我们可以更好地理解该文件所涵盖的内容和技术要求。
相关推荐
Alysa其诗闻
- 粉丝: 28
- 资源: 4683
最新资源
- 手把手,教你入门WINOLS(入门篇).rar
- AWT
- table_calendar:高度可定制的功能丰富的日历小部件,适用于Flutter
- 家具进销存管理软件 宏达家具进销存管理系统 v3.0
- rhodeswiki
- astarisx:适用于React的高度可组合MVVM框架
- python-json-logger:用于标准python记录器的Json Formatter
- 星期六AI:挑战Tareas de AIS星期六
- 5种炫酷js鼠标跟随动画特效插件
- plot3Dmeshgrid:plot3Dmeshgrid(X,Y,Z) 绘制由函数 [Xgrid,Ygrid,Zgrid] = meshgrid(X,Y,Z) 返回的 3D 网格-matlab开发
- measure.zip中文版
- dislocker:FUSE驱动程序在Linux Mac OSX下读写Windows的BitLocker版本
- Java的dubbo.xsd配置文件
- slider_animate:创建滑块控制的动画-matlab开发
- 骰子滚动游戏是计算机掷骰子,然后用户掷骰子获得最高分。骰子滚动游戏是“计算机”掷骰子。骰子,然后用户掷骰子,最高分获胜。 胜利加起来,如果愿意的话,球员们可以再次打球,然后比分提高。 一旦玩家选择退出,总分就会显示出来
- moonfair.github.io